Idaho Power employees recently teamed up to make the holiday season a little brighter for local families in need. Thanks to a contribution for our Employee Community Funds and donations from employees at Langley Gulch Power Plant, the Payette Office and Payette Substation, the company donated more than 1,000 pounds of turkey to the Payette Western Idaho Community Action Partnership and Ontario Food Bank. Energy Advisors Dani Rollins and Jerry Nelson delivered 44 birds to each pantry on behalf of Idaho Power.
